Average car shipping cost from West Virginia

Short routes under 500 miles typically run $300–$600. Mid-range routes (500–1,500 miles) average $600–$1,100. Cross-country shipments over 1,500 miles generally range from $1,000–$1,600 for open transport.

Open vs. enclosed transport in West Virginia

Open transport is the standard choice — safe, affordable, and how most daily drivers are moved. Enclosed adds 30–50% and is recommended for luxury, classic, or exotic vehicles.

How long does car shipping from West Virginia take?+

Short routes under 500 miles take 1–3 days. Mid-range routes take 3–7 days. Cross-country shipments typically take 7–10 days.

Is open or enclosed transport better?+

Open transport is safe and most popular. Enclosed is recommended for luxury, classic, or exotic vehicles and costs 30–50% more.
